The Cast and Their Iconic Roles in The Emperor's New Groove

Let's start with the stars, shall we? The Emperor's New Groove boasts an all-star cast that, frankly, is a gift that keeps on giving. David Spade, the comedic genius we all know and love, takes on the role of the arrogant and hilariously self-absorbed Emperor Kuzco. Spade’s delivery is pure gold; he perfectly captures Kuzco's transformation from a spoiled brat to a slightly less spoiled, but ultimately lovable, emperor. The sheer range he brings to the character, from haughty pronouncements to desperate pleas, is what makes Kuzco so darn compelling. Then we have John Goodman, a legend in his own right, who voices Pacha, the good-hearted llama herder. Goodman’s warmth and everyman quality create a perfect balance to Spade’s over-the-top antics. He is the heart and soul of the film. He provides the grounded reality that Kuzco desperately needs, and their dynamic is one of the most heartwarming aspects of the movie. Now, we can't forget Eartha Kitt, the purr-fectly villainous Yzma! Her performance is absolutely iconic, a masterclass in comedic villainy. Her unique voice, full of theatrical flair and wicked wit, is the icing on the cake, and her comedic timing is impeccable. She delivers lines like "Pull the lever, Kronk!" with a delicious sense of over-the-top evilness that makes her a standout. Last, but certainly not least, there’s Patrick Warburton as Kronk, Yzma's lovable, dim-witted henchman. Warburton's signature deadpan delivery and deep voice are perfect for Kronk, and the internal struggle between his good and evil sides is pure comedic genius. Voice Acting vs. On-Screen Acting

Okay, so, voice acting is a special craft, but how does it stack up against on-screen acting? While both require talent, the approach is different. On-screen actors have to use their entire body to convey emotion, from facial expressions to body language. It's a visual medium, and their physicality is an integral part of their performance. Voice actors, on the other hand, are limited to their voice. They must rely on vocal inflections, timing, and emphasis to convey the same emotions. This can make voice acting particularly challenging because the actor has to communicate everything through their voice. They have to capture the audience's attention without the visual cues that on-screen actors have at their disposal. Voice acting demands a unique skill set. Voice actors need strong vocal control. They must be able to change their voice to match different characters, emotions, and situations. They need great comedic timing to deliver the perfect punchline. They also need the ability to create believable characters, even though the audience only hears their voice. Dive into Voice Acting: Tips and Tricks

So, you’re thinking about becoming a voice actor, huh? Awesome! Here are some tips to get you started on your voice-acting journey. First things first: Practice, practice, practice! Read aloud as often as possible. Try reading different genres, from poetry to scripts. This helps you hone your vocal skills and get comfortable with different styles of delivery. Record yourself. Listen back to your recordings and identify areas where you can improve. Pay attention to your pronunciation, pacing, and overall delivery. Take classes or workshops. Learn from experienced voice actors and coaches to develop your skills. This is the best way to get practical guidance and feedback. Develop your range. Experiment with different voices, accents, and characterizations. The more versatile you are, the more opportunities you’ll have. Build a demo reel. Once you have some experience, create a demo reel showcasing your best work. This is your portfolio, and it’s what potential clients will use to assess your skills. Network. Connect with other voice actors, casting directors, and industry professionals. Networking is essential for finding work and making your mark in the voice-acting world. Be persistent. Voice acting can be a competitive field, so don’t get discouraged by rejection. Keep honing your skills, and never stop pursuing your goals. Find your niche. There are a variety of voice acting gigs. Consider what areas you're most interested in, like animation, commercials, audiobooks, or video games. Get a home studio. You don't need a fancy setup, but having a quiet space and quality recording equipment will give you a competitive edge. Join voice acting groups online. These groups can be a wealth of information, from audition opportunities to advice from seasoned professionals. Becoming a voice actor requires dedication, hard work, and a love for the art. Essential Voice Acting Skills

Okay, let's break down some of the essential skills you'll need if you want to make it in the voice-acting world. First and foremost, you'll need vocal control. This is your ability to use your voice in different ways – to change pitch, pace, volume, and tone. It's what allows you to create different characters and convey different emotions. Next up is character development. You must be able to create a believable character. This means understanding their personality, motivations, and the way they speak. Voice acting isn't just about reading lines; it's about embodying a character. Another key skill is improvisation. The ability to think on your feet and come up with lines or adjustments is often needed. Many voice acting roles require this skill. Good comedic timing is essential, especially if you want to work in animation or comedy. You need to know when to deliver a punchline and how to make the audience laugh. Great pronunciation and diction are also must-haves. You need to speak clearly and understandably so your audience can follow what you’re saying. The ability to take direction is also crucial. Voice acting often involves working with directors and producers who will offer feedback and instructions. You need to be able to understand and implement their guidance. Patience is another essential skill. The voice acting world can be competitive, and it can take time to get noticed. Also, it’s not just about a pretty voice. You need to be able to act through your voice! Whether it is a villain, hero or the sidekick. Being able to convey emotions without the use of facial expressions or body language is a true talent.
